The ingredients needed to make Macrobiotic Brown Rice Onigiri:
  1. Prepare Uncooked brown rice
  2. Make ready Umeboshi
  3. Make ready approx. 1 1/2 tablespoons Walnuts
  4. Take Aburaage
  5. Get Soy sauce
  6. Get Salt
  7. Get Nori
Steps to make Macrobiotic Brown Rice Onigiri:
  1. Soak the brown rice in 400 ml of water overnight. Cook with a pinch of salt in a pressure cooker for 20 minutes.
  2. Blanch the aburaage in boiling water to remove any excess oil, and fry in a pan until golden brown. Drizzle with soy sauce to season, and finely chop.
  3. Roast the walnuts in the frying pan and chop into fine pieces. Remove the pits from the umeboshi, and mash into a paste.
  4. Once the brown rice is done, mix together with the aburaage, chopped walnuts and umeboshi paste. Coat your hands in salt, and form into rice balls.
  5. Wrap in nori, and they're done!!
